Searched refs:next_bridge (Results 1 - 25 of 53) sorted by last modified time

123

/linux-master/drivers/gpu/drm/bridge/
H A Dsii902x.c170 struct drm_bridge *next_bridge; member in struct:sii902x
424 return drm_bridge_attach(bridge->encoder, sii902x->next_bridge,
1166 sii902x->next_bridge = of_drm_find_bridge(remote);
1168 if (!sii902x->next_bridge)
H A Dti-dlpc3433.c58 struct drm_bridge *next_bridge; member in struct:dlpc
250 return drm_bridge_attach(bridge->encoder, dlpc->next_bridge, bridge, flags);
285 dlpc->next_bridge = devm_drm_of_get_bridge(dev, dev->of_node, 1, 0);
286 if (IS_ERR(dlpc->next_bridge))
287 return PTR_ERR(dlpc->next_bridge);
H A Dtc358764.c152 struct drm_bridge *next_bridge; member in struct:tc358764
302 return drm_bridge_attach(bridge->encoder, ctx->next_bridge, bridge, flags);
321 ctx->next_bridge = devm_drm_of_get_bridge(dev, dev->of_node, 1, 0);
322 if (IS_ERR(ctx->next_bridge))
323 return PTR_ERR(ctx->next_bridge);
H A Dlontium-lt9611.c38 struct drm_bridge *next_bridge; member in struct:lt9611
792 return drm_bridge_attach(bridge->encoder, lt9611->next_bridge,
920 return drm_of_find_panel_or_bridge(dev->of_node, 2, -1, NULL, &lt9611->next_bridge);
H A Dite-it66121.c300 struct drm_bridge *next_bridge; member in struct:it66121_ctx
597 ret = drm_bridge_attach(bridge->encoder, ctx->next_bridge, bridge, flags);
1543 ctx->next_bridge = of_drm_find_bridge(ep);
1545 if (!ctx->next_bridge) {
/linux-master/drivers/gpu/drm/xlnx/
H A Dzynqmp_dp.c285 * @next_bridge: The downstream bridge
306 struct drm_bridge *next_bridge; member in struct:zynqmp_dp
1356 if (dp->next_bridge) {
1357 ret = drm_bridge_attach(bridge->encoder, dp->next_bridge,
1788 &dp->next_bridge);
/linux-master/drivers/gpu/drm/msm/hdmi/
H A Dhdmi.c176 if (hdmi->next_bridge) {
177 ret = drm_bridge_attach(hdmi->encoder, hdmi->next_bridge, hdmi->bridge,
416 ret = drm_of_find_panel_or_bridge(pdev->dev.of_node, 1, 0, NULL, &hdmi->next_bridge);
H A Dhdmi.h65 struct drm_bridge *next_bridge; member in struct:hdmi
/linux-master/drivers/gpu/drm/msm/dsi/
H A Ddsi_manager.c432 return drm_bridge_attach(bridge->encoder, msm_dsi->next_bridge,
H A Ddsi.h41 struct drm_bridge *next_bridge; member in struct:msm_dsi
H A Ddsi.c136 msm_dsi->next_bridge = ext_bridge;
/linux-master/drivers/gpu/drm/msm/dp/
H A Ddp_drm.c340 if (dp_display->next_bridge) {
342 dp_display->next_bridge, bridge,
H A Ddp_display.c1228 dp->next_bridge = devm_drm_of_get_bridge(&dp->pdev->dev, dp->pdev->dev.of_node, 1, 0);
1229 if (IS_ERR(dp->next_bridge)) {
1230 ret = PTR_ERR(dp->next_bridge);
1231 dp->next_bridge = NULL;
1696 /* Without next_bridge interrupts are handled by the DP core directly */
H A Ddp_display.h20 struct drm_bridge *next_bridge; member in struct:msm_dp
/linux-master/drivers/gpu/drm/mediatek/
H A Dmtk_hdmi.c156 struct drm_bridge *next_bridge; member in struct:mtk_hdmi
1211 struct drm_bridge *next_bridge; local
1217 next_bridge = drm_bridge_get_next_bridge(&hdmi->bridge);
1218 if (next_bridge) {
1222 if (!drm_bridge_chain_mode_fixup(next_bridge, mode,
1303 if (hdmi->next_bridge) {
1304 ret = drm_bridge_attach(bridge->encoder, hdmi->next_bridge,
1499 hdmi->next_bridge = of_drm_find_bridge(remote);
1500 if (!hdmi->next_bridge) {
H A Dmtk_dsi.c197 struct drm_bridge *next_bridge; member in struct:mtk_dsi
733 return drm_bridge_attach(bridge->encoder, dsi->next_bridge,
907 dsi->next_bridge = devm_drm_of_get_bridge(dev, dev->of_node, 0, 0);
908 if (IS_ERR(dsi->next_bridge))
909 return PTR_ERR(dsi->next_bridge);
H A Dmtk_dpi.c66 struct drm_bridge *next_bridge; member in struct:mtk_dpi
708 return drm_bridge_attach(bridge->encoder, dpi->next_bridge,
1058 dpi->next_bridge = devm_drm_of_get_bridge(dev, dev->of_node, 0, 0);
1059 if (IS_ERR(dpi->next_bridge))
1060 return dev_err_probe(dev, PTR_ERR(dpi->next_bridge),
1063 dev_info(dev, "Found bridge node: %pOF\n", dpi->next_bridge->of_node);
H A Dmtk_dp.c115 struct drm_bridge *next_bridge; member in struct:mtk_dp
2201 if (mtk_dp->next_bridge) {
2202 ret = drm_bridge_attach(bridge->encoder, mtk_dp->next_bridge,
2579 mtk_dp->next_bridge = devm_drm_of_get_bridge(dev, dev->of_node, 1, 0);
2587 if (IS_ERR(mtk_dp->next_bridge)) {
2588 ret = PTR_ERR(mtk_dp->next_bridge);
2589 mtk_dp->next_bridge = NULL;
/linux-master/drivers/gpu/drm/
H A Ddrm_bridge.c1081 struct drm_bridge *next_bridge; local
1090 next_bridge = drm_bridge_get_next_bridge(bridge);
1102 if (!next_bridge) {
1106 next_bridge);
/linux-master/drivers/gpu/drm/bridge/synopsys/
H A Ddw-hdmi.c134 struct drm_bridge *next_bridge; member in struct:dw_hdmi
2900 return drm_bridge_attach(bridge->encoder, hdmi->next_bridge,
3306 hdmi->next_bridge = of_drm_find_bridge(remote);
3308 if (!hdmi->next_bridge)
/linux-master/drivers/gpu/drm/bridge/imx/
H A Dimx8mp-hdmi-pvi.c32 struct drm_bridge *next_bridge; member in struct:imx8mp_hdmi_pvi
47 return drm_bridge_attach(bridge->encoder, pvi->next_bridge,
79 if (pvi->next_bridge->timings)
80 bus_flags = pvi->next_bridge->timings->input_bus_flags;
109 struct drm_bridge *next_bridge = pvi->next_bridge; local
112 if (!next_bridge->funcs->atomic_get_input_bus_fmts)
116 next_bridge);
118 return next_bridge->funcs->atomic_get_input_bus_fmts(next_bridge,
[all...]
/linux-master/drivers/gpu/drm/bridge/adv7511/
H A Dadv7511_drv.c955 if (adv->next_bridge) {
956 ret = drm_bridge_attach(bridge->encoder, adv->next_bridge, bridge, flags);
1232 &adv7511->next_bridge);
H A Dadv7511.h359 struct drm_bridge *next_bridge; member in struct:adv7511
/linux-master/drivers/gpu/drm/imx/ipuv3/
H A Dparallel-display.c42 struct drm_bridge *next_bridge; member in struct:imx_parallel_display
205 struct drm_bridge *next_bridge; local
208 next_bridge = drm_bridge_get_next_bridge(bridge);
209 if (next_bridge)
211 next_bridge);
291 if (imxpd->next_bridge) {
292 ret = drm_bridge_attach(encoder, imxpd->next_bridge, bridge, 0);
328 &imxpd->next_bridge);
/linux-master/drivers/gpu/drm/omapdrm/dss/
H A Dhdmi5.c322 return drm_bridge_attach(bridge->encoder, hdmi->output.next_bridge,

Completed in 353 milliseconds

123